Output 369603ab98eef1f16b7cd53a22b39ff506bf4b74db21d643724efc11fc4b43dc:3

value
1406550032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b891a3c8031110e0d386fbbf8f61b24de2dbb1c OP_EQUAL
address
35fDDqgahEB2G121QgPwdKZSCJPfhDu29o
transaction
369603ab98eef1f16b7cd53a22b39ff506bf4b74db21d643724efc11fc4b43dc
spent
true